Elevating Product Labels and Packaging Design
One of the most effective ways to utilize Icter is in packaging design and product labeling. If you sell handmade goods, such as organic skincare, small-batch preserves, or luxury textiles, your label is your silent salesperson. The sturdy, calligraphic letterforms of Icter are uniquely characterized by rhythmic, hand-drawn qualities that mimic the care put into crafting the product itself. This connection between the font’s aesthetic and the physical product creates a cohesive brand experience.
Consider a local coffee roaster or a craft brewery. Using Icter for the main logo or the variety name on the bag or bottle adds a layer of sophistication. It moves the product away from looking like a commodity and positions it as a premium item. However, readability is key. Because Icter is a Display font, it works best at larger sizes. Use it for the brand name or the primary product title, but pair it with a clean, highly readable sans serif or serif font for the ingredients list, nutritional facts, or detailed descriptions. This combination ensures that while your brand looks artistic and high-end, the essential information remains accessible to the consumer.

Strategic Font Pairing for Web and Print Materials
To get the most out of Icter, you must understand how to pair it effectively. As a display typeface, it is designed to shine in headlines, logos, and short bursts of text. It is not intended for long paragraphs of body copy. For a balanced and professional look, pair Icter with a neutral, modern sans serif font for your website body text, blog articles, and detailed service descriptions. This contrast highlights the beauty of Icter’s calligraphic details while ensuring that your content remains easy to read on mobile devices and desktop screens.
For printed materials like menus, flyers, or brochures, this pairing strategy is equally important. A café owner might use Icter for the section headers (e.g., "Espresso," "Pastries") and the item names, while using a simple, clean font for the descriptions and prices. This hierarchy guides the customer’s eye through the menu logically. Similarly, for wedding invitations or event signage, Icter can serve as the primary decorative element, conveying elegance and formality, while a complementary script or simple serif handles the logistical details like dates and locations.
